Use rubber linings wherever possible due to lifetime, low weight, easy to install and noise dampening.; When application is getting tougher use steel-capped rubber, still easier to handle than steel.; When these both options are overruled (by temperature, feed size or chemicals) use steel.; Ore-bed is a lining with rubber covered permanent magnets used for special ...

Plant design is based on a standard porphyry copper flow sheet employing SAG and ball milling, flotation, regrinding, thickening and filtering to produce a copper concentrate at a moisture content of 8% for export. Ball mill product feeds a bank of six 200 m³ rougher flotation cells followed by a 180 m3 scavenger/sulphide tank cell.Throughput rate (new feed) 795 dry mtph (average per mill) Ore feed size F80 2,200 microns Ore product size P80 150 microns Recirculating Load design 350 Special Design Considerations For Grinding Mills Driven By Dual Pinion Low Speed Drives In the past, mills driven by a dual pinion drive option have utilized an air clutch not only to start

In the rolling process, the job is drawn through a set of rolls due to interface friction, and the compressive forces reduce the thickness of the workpiece or change in its cross-sectional area.. The types of rolls used in rolling mills are depended upon the shape, size and the gap between the rolls and their contour.
